Transaction

05b4cfdf2f736fec62d87fc1095bddd61a768b24291e8817aa268d8ed690e1d4
519,717 confirmations
Timestamp
1467767770
Block419,483
Fee20,000 sats
Fee rate88.9 sats/vB
view on mempool.space

Inputs & Outputs